Mashgin Raises $62.5M in Series B Funding at a $1.5 Billion Valuation
Summary
Mashgin, a Palo Alto, Ca-based touchless self-checkout system powered by AI and computer vision, raised $62.5m in Series B funding at a $1.5 billion post-money valuation. The round, which brings Mashgin’s total funding to date to $74.7m, was led by NEA, with participation from Matrix Partners. Founded in 2013 and led by Chief Technology Officer Mukul Dhankar and CEO Abhinai Srivastava, Mashgin provides a self-checkout system powered by AI and computer vision, which enables consumers to get instant gratification and retailers to get revenue. Mashgin kiosks are currently deployed in more than 800 locations, including convenience stores, iconic sports stadiums, arenas and entertainment venues, airports, universities, corporate and hospital cafeterias. There’s no need to look for and scan bar codes: customers place their items on the company’s tray, and pay electronically.
